Meet Singapore-based Oasys. It has just launched a gaming-focused blockchain, and we hear it might truly be revolutionary. 🤯
Cross-platform. First off, it looks to connect gamers across the metaverse, allowing them to bring in-game items across games and platforms if the game is part of the Oasys Ecosystem.
😎 But wait, there's more
Dream team. Founding team members include top gaming and blockchain execs Gabby Dizon (Yield Guild Games), Shuji Utsumi (Sega), Hajime Nakatani (Bandai Namco), Hironobu Ueno (Double Jump Tokyo/MyCryptHeroes) and Hironao Kunimitsu (Gumi/Thirdverse).
